Best time to go to Hida

The best time to visit Hida is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. August is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with frequent r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with moderate r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January21.9°F (-5.6°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
February24.1°F (-4.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
March32.9°F (0.5°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
April43.7°F (6.5°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
May54.9°F (12.7°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June62.2°F (16.8°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
July69.1°F (20.6°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
August70.2°F (21.2°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
September62.4°F (16.9°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
October50.7°F (10.4°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ly High
November39.2°F (4.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
December27.7°F (-2.4°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age

The nearest major airports for your trip to Hida

Reaching Hida, Gifu Prefecture is convenient via its major airports. Nagoya (NKM-Komaki) is situated 124km away, with nearby hotels such as the 4.5-star Nagoya Tokyu Hotel and the 4.5-star Nagoya Marriott Associa Hotel, both approximately 5-10km from the airport. Matsumoto (MMJ-Shinshu - Matsumoto) is 68km from Hida, offering excellent accommodation like the 4-star Matsumoto Marunouchi Hotel, just 10km away. Komatsu (KMQ) is located 71km away, featuring the 4-star Rurikoh Ryokan. What's the seasonal weather like in Hida?
The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 19°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of -3°C. The rainiest months in Hida are July, September, August and June, with each month seeing an average of 333 mm of rainfall.
